There are several options for getting from Alba to Avellino by train, plane, bus and car. The cheapest option is to take the bus which costs around €54 ($54) and will take around 13hrs. If you need to get there more quickly, you can take the train, then fly and then take the bus and arrive in approximately 4h 25m, though it is a bit more costly at approximately €73 ($73).
The distance between Alba and Avellino is around 796km (495 miles). In a direct line (as the crow flies), the distance is 693km (431 miles)
It takes around 4h 25m to get from Alba and Avellino by train, plane and bus. If you are travelling by car it will take around 8h 5m to drive there.
The quickest way to get from Alba to Avellino is to take the train, then fly and then take the bus which takes around 4h 25m and will set you back approx €73 ($73).
The cheapest way to travel between Alba and Avellino, if you exclude driving, is to take the bus which will typically cost around €54 ($54) for a standard one-way ticket.
There is no train service that runs between Alba and Avellino. We recommend that you take the train to Torino Porta Susa then fly from Turin (TRN) to Naples (NAP) then take the bus to Tribunale. instead which will take 4h 25m.
Yes there is a bus that runs regularly from Alba and Avellino. It typically takes around 13hrs and departs twice a week.
There are no direct bus services that runs from Alba to Avellino. However, you can instead can take several connecting buses with changeovers in Asti - Piazzale Antistante F.S. - Piazza Marconi and Naples Metropark Central Parking. These services run twice a week and will take a minimum of 13hrs.
Itabus, Air Campania S.r.l. and Sellitto run regular bus services between Alba and Avellino. Buses run twice a week and take around 13hrs on average but will vary depending on you book with.

The closest major airport to Avellino is Naples International Airport (NAP) (NAP) which is approximately 42km (26 miles) from Avellino. Bari Karol Wojtyła Airport (BRI) (BRI) and Ciampino–G.B. Pastine International Airport (CIA) (CIA) are also nearby and might be a better alternative airport depending on where you are flying from.
Yes it is possible to drive from Alba and Avellino. The distance is around 888km (552 miles) by road and it will take around 8h 5m in normal traffic conditons.
